Scientists long believed the eruption had sterilized the island, making it a blank slate for new life to colonize. Yet the author meticulously examines historical accounts, scientific data, and firsthand observations to challenge this notion. Their findings suggest the possibility that life on Krakatau was not entirely extinguished after all. The author delves into the intricate processes of plant and animal recolonization, raising questions about the resilience of life and the remarkable power of nature to reclaim even the most devastated landscapes. Their research opens up new avenues for understanding the intricate relationship between life and its environment, offering fresh insights into the fundamental principles of ecology and evolution.
